The best way to remove blackheads is by using exfoliating ingredients, regulating oil production, and keeping pores clear.
To remove deep-rooted blackheads, you can use exfoliating scrubs, pore strips, or clay masks to unclog pores. Another option is to consider professional treatments such as chemical peels or ...
